Script Edgog 7 is a bold, normal width, high contrast, italic, short x-height font.

A slanted, brush-leaning script with pronounced thick–thin modulation and smoothly tapered terminals. Letterforms show rounded bowls, soft joins, and frequent entry/exit strokes that create a flowing rhythm, with selective looped ascenders/descenders and occasional swash-like strokes on capitals. The overall texture is compact and dark, with sturdy downstrokes, open counters where possible, and a slightly irregular, hand-led cadence that keeps it lively while remaining controlled.
Well-suited for short to medium display text where its contrast and swashy movement can shine—logos, product labels, café/retail branding, event materials, and poster headlines. It can also work for pull quotes or section headers when generous spacing and size are used to preserve clarity.
The font conveys a polished, nostalgic friendliness—expressive without feeling chaotic. Its sweeping capitals and confident stroke contrast give it a celebratory, boutique tone that reads as personable and slightly retro.
The design appears aimed at delivering a refined handwritten script feel—combining brushy warmth with deliberate, calligraphic structure—so designers can achieve an upscale, personable look with strong headline impact.
Capitals are especially decorative and prominent, adding emphasis at word starts. Numerals follow the same calligraphic logic with angled stress and rounded forms, keeping the set visually cohesive in display settings.
